Temperature

The average high-temperature is a still warm 28°C (82.4°F) in May, hardly different from the 27.3°C (81.1°F) recorded in April. Throughout May, Ashton records a steady low-temperature average of 27.1°C (80.8°F), a minor decrease from its daytime counterpart.

Heat index

The heat index value during May is calculated to be a hot 32°C (89.6°F). If one continues to be active during exposure, it might cause tiredness and subsequent heat cramps.
Be aware that heat index ratings are designed for shaded locations and minor breezes. Heat index values may rise by up to 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ees when exposed to direct sunlight.
Note: The heat index, also known as 'apparent temperature' or 'feels like', comes about by integrating the temperature readings with the humidity levels. The effect of weather is individual, with a variety of people experiencing it differently due to distinctions in body mass, height, and level of activity. Direct sun exposure is noteworthy in its ability to escalate the felt temperature, potentially adding 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ees to the heat index. Heat index values are highly critical to babies and toddlers. Youngsters frequently overlook the need for breaks and fluid intake. Thirst is an advanced sign of dehydration - thereby highlighting the importance of keeping hydrated, particularly during long physical activities.

Humidity

The months with the highest humidity are May through July, with an average relative humidity of 78%.

Rainfall

In Ashton, in May, it is raining for 19.1 days, with typically 29mm (1.14") of accumulated precipitation. In Ashton, during the entire year, the rain falls for 238.6 days and collects up to 627mm (24.69") of precipitation.

Sea temperature

In Ashton, in May, the average water temperature is 28°C (82.4°F).
Note: Water activities in temperatures ranging from 25°C (77°F) to 29°C (84.2°F) are pleasurable, without feeling uncomfortable even during extended periods.

Daylight

The average length of the day in May is 12h and 43min.
On the first day of May, sunrise is at 05:45 and sunset at 18:20. On the last day of the month, sunrise is at 05:39 and sunset at 18:28 AST.

Sunshine

The average sunshine in May is 9.8h.

Average temperature in May
Ashton,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
  • Average high temperature in May: 28°C

The warmest month (with the highest average high temperature) is September (28.8°C).
The month with the lowest average high temperature is February (26.5°C).

  • Average low temperature in May: 27.1°C

The month with the highest average low temperature is September (28°C).
The coldest month (with the lowest average low temperature) is February (25.7°C).

Average rainfall in May
Ashton,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
  • Average rainfall in May: 29mm

The wettest month (with the highest rainfall) is August (94mm).
The driest month (with the least rainfall) is February (23mm).

Average rainfall days in May
Ashton,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
  • Average rainfall days in May: 19.1 days

The month with the highest number of rainy days is August (24.3 days).
The month with the least rainy days is February (14.8 days).
